BMD records for the year in which Stuart was born are not freely available on the net, nor would the entry of George and Edith's marriage be freely available. You can visit
http://www.1837online.com and pay for credits to search the surname indexes to find say, George's marriage to Edith circa 1944 however, if George was in the Armed Forces during the war they may have married earlier. I might also add that Brooker does not appear to be a common name in Lincolnshire, so the chances are that any Brooker births circa 1944 in Louth may very well indicate further offspring of George and Edith.
